This project studies how the prenatal language environment influences fetal brain development and language acquisition. By examining neural plasticity and speech processing in fetuses, it aims to understand the impact of auditory experiences on language learning in infants.
The prenatal period represents a critical window in which key neural structures and functions are shaped, laying the foundation for sensory processing, language learning, and cognitive function throughout an individual's lifetime.
While research recognizes the importance of prenatal auditory and language stimulation, it is unclear whether and to what degree the language environment in utero shapes the fetal brain and language acquisition after birth.
